With a long-awaited $1 billion multiyear contract in hand to deliver 32 C-130J aircraft, Lockheed Martin is poised to sustain its Hercules production line at least through the end of the decade. The contract is the first cut of a larger $5.3 billion deal to deliver 78 C-130J airlifters through 2020.
